Note for the security review of Spanfold, our diff viewer for large files: CI started failing on the 2 GB fixture suite after we enabled memory-mapped rendering. The failure is an OOM in the chunk indexer, not a sandbox escape; no untrusted input crosses the boundary. Repro is deterministic on the runner class we pin. The affected artifact is the build referenced below.

session token of tajef-bageg = htk21_5d90d574934f3ccae6437

The Granwick CSV Import Wizard validates headers, coerces types, and quarantines malformed rows before anything touches the Ledgerline database. All mappings are signed per tenant. If the signing keystore is rotated or lost, imports halt until the vault is reopened. For that contingency, the reviewer copy includes the passphrase below.

unlock words, kajef-kadug: sorys-pelax-lamael-tamvan-briiel-novdor-fenwyn-tamdor-oliion-keleth-julok-belion-ralok

## Session handling — Tansybar consent banner rollout

Heads up, future maintainers: the consent banner writes its choice into the session before any analytics cookies load, so ordering matters. If the session store is cold, we show the banner again rather than guessing. When testing the consent API in staging, send requests with the bearer token below.

session JWT of yawep-yawep = eyJhbGciOiJIUzI1NiIsInR5cCI6IkpXVCJ9.eyJzdWIiOiI3pWF3_In0.aXYsHiog

Subject: DR drill — Gridhawk admin bulk edits

Reviewing Friday's failover of the Gridhawk admin console. Bulk-edit jobs will be paused mid-batch to test resumability; please review the patch that checkpoints row ranges before approving. Watch for partial writes in the audit log during cutover. Standby DB credentials sit in the sealed vault — after the checkpoint review passes, unseal it with the passphrase noted just below.

unlock words, fawif-hahip: eliax-ulador-holdor-novix-prawyn-norius-kelax-weniel-alddor-ulaion

When retrying failed charges through Paylune, always reuse the original idempotency key from the ledger row; generating a fresh key will double-bill the customer. Keys expire after 48 hours, after which the charge must be manually reconciled. The retry worker signs each request, and the next line sets the secret it signs with.

vault entry, kafog-yahop: COURIER_KEY8=0faa53ae